Q: Is 77,388 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 77,388 is not a prime number.

Why is 77,388 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 77388 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 6,449 12,898 19,347 25,796 38,694 and 77,388, with no remainder.

Since 77,388 cannot be divided by just 1 and 77,388, it is not a prime number.
